Home
last modified time | relevance | path

Searched refs:hy (Results 1 – 25 of 107) sorted by last modified time

12345

/illumos-gate/usr/src/lib/libmvec/common/vis/
H A D__vatan2.S81 ! o0 hy
169 ld [%i1],%o0 ! hy
213 sub %l3,%o0,%l0 ! hx - hy
627 bge,pn %icc,1f ! if hx - hy >= 0x03600000
691 bl,pt %icc,1f ! if hy < 0x7ff00000
H A D__vpow.S664 ! hy = ((unsigned*)py)[0];
667 ! sy = hy >> 31;
669 ! hy &= 0x7fffffff;
695 ! hy > 0x7ff00000 || (hy == 0x7ff00000 && ly != 0))
704 ! ((int*)pz)[0] = hy;
947 ! hy = ((unsigned*)py)[0];
951 ! sy = hy >> 31;
952 ! hy &= 0x7fffffff;
966 ! ((int*)pz)[0] = hy;
971 ! if (hy >= 0x7ff00000) {
[all …]
H A D__vhypotf.S93 ! if ( hx >= 0x7f3504f3 || hy >= 0x7f3504f3 )
111 ! if ( (hx | hy) == 0 )
217 cmp %l4,_0x7f3504f3 ! (3_0) hy ? 0x7f3504f3
246 cmp %l4,_0x7f3504f3 ! (4_1) hy ? 0x7f3504f3
273 cmp %l4,_0x7f3504f3 ! (0_0) hy ? 0x7f3504f3
299 cmp %l4,_0x7f3504f3 ! (1_0) hy ? 0x7f3504f3
342 cmp %l4,_0x7f3504f3 ! (2_0) hy ? 0x7f3504f3
832 cmp %l4,%i0 ! hy ? 0x7f800000
833 bge,pt %icc,2f ! if ( hy >= 0x7f800000 )
859 cmp %l4,%i0 ! hy ? 0x7f800000
[all …]
H A D__vhypot.S82 ! hy = *(int*)py;
85 ! hy &= 0x7fffffff;
88 ! if ( j0 < hy ) j0 = hy;
93 ! else if ( hy == 0x7ff00000 && ly == 0 ) res = x == y ? x : y;
101 ! diff = hy - hx;
839 sub %o0,%l4,%o0 ! diff = hy - hx;
908 cmp %l4,%o4 ! hy ? 0x7ff00000
909 bne,pn %icc,1f ! if ( hy != 0x7ff00000 )
/illumos-gate/usr/src/pkg/manifests/
H A Dlocale-hy.p5m15 set name=pkg.fmri value=pkg:/locale/hy@$(PKGVERS)
/illumos-gate/usr/src/lib/libmvec/common/
H A D__vrhypot.c133 hy##I = HI(py); \
135 hy##I &= 0x7fffffff; \
137 if (hx##I >= 0x7ff00000 || hy##I >= 0x7ff00000) /* |X| or |Y| = Inf,NaN */ \
144 else if (hy##I == 0x7ff00000 && ly == 0) res0 = 0.0; /* |Y| = Inf */ \
151 diff0 = hy##I - hx##I; \
153 if (hx##I < 0x00100000 && hy##I < 0x00100000) /* |X| and |Y| = subnormal or zero */ \
160 if ((hx##I | hy##I | lx | ly) == 0) /* |X| and |Y| = 0 */ \
202 j0 = hy##I - (diff0 & j0); \
H A D__vpow.c520 hy = HI(py); \
523 sy = hy >> 31; \
525 hy &= 0x7fffffff; \
557 hy > 0x7ff00000 || (hy == 0x7ff00000 && ly != 0)) /* |X| or |Y| = Nan */ \
567 HI(pz) = hy; \
696 unsigned hx, lx, sx, hy, ly, sy; in __vpow() local
1081 hy = HI(py); \
1083 sy = hy >> 31; \
1084 hy &= 0x7fffffff; \
1100 HI(pz) = hy; \
[all …]
H A D__vatan2.c79 hy = HI(y); in __vatan2()
88 if (hy > hx || (hy == hx && LO(y) > LO(x))) in __vatan2()
91 hx = hy; in __vatan2()
92 hy = i; in __vatan2()
194 hy = HI(y); in __vatan2()
203 if (hy > hx || (hy == hx && LO(y) > LO(x))) in __vatan2()
206 hx = hy; in __vatan2()
207 hy = i; in __vatan2()
318 if (hy > hx || (hy == hx && LO(y) > LO(x))) in __vatan2()
321 hx = hy; in __vatan2()
[all …]
/illumos-gate/usr/src/lib/libm/common/m9x/
H A Dremquo.c78 if (hx <= hy) { in fmodquo()
79 if (hx < hy || lx < ly) in fmodquo()
102 if (hy == 0) { in fmodquo()
110 iy = (hy >> 20) - 1023; in fmodquo()
126 hy = 0x00100000 | (0x000fffff & hy); in fmodquo()
130 hy = (hy << n) | (ly >> (32 - n)); in fmodquo()
133 hy = ly << (n - 32); in fmodquo()
142 hz = hx - hy; in fmodquo()
165 hz = hx - hy; in fmodquo()
213 int hx, hy, sx, sq; in remquo() local
[all …]
H A Dremquof.c215 int hx, hy, sx, sq; in remquof() local
219 hy = *(int *) &y; /* high word of y */ in remquof()
221 sq = (hx ^ hy) & is; /* sign of x/y */ in remquof()
223 hy &= 0x7fffffff; /* |y| */ in remquof()
227 if (hx >= ii || hy > ii || hy == 0) { in remquof()
234 if (hy <= 0x7f7fffff) { in remquof()
238 if (hy < 0x01000000) { in remquof()
H A Dremquol.c295 int hx, hy, sx, sq; in remquol() local
299 hy = __H0(y); /* high word of y */ in remquol()
301 sq = (hx ^ hy) & is; /* sign of x/y */ in remquol()
303 hy &= ~0x80000000; in remquol()
313 if (hy <= 0x7ffdffff) { in remquol()
317 if (hy < 0x00020000) { in remquol()
H A Dfmal.c106 hy = yy.i[0] & ~0x80000000; in __fmal()
131 if (hy >= 0x7fff0000) { in __fmal()
133 if (!(hy & 0x8000)) { in __fmal()
142 } else if (hy == 0) { in __fmal()
292 ey = hy >> 16; in __fmal()
293 hy &= 0xffff; in __fmal()
298 hy = yy.i[1]; in __fmal()
304 hy = yy.i[2]; in __fmal()
309 hy = yy.i[3]; in __fmal()
314 hy = (hy << 1) | (yy.i[1] >> 31); in __fmal()
[all …]
H A Dfma.c78 int hx, hy, hz, ex, ey, ez, exy, sxy, sz, e, ibit; in __fma() local
86 hy = yy.i[0] & ~0x80000000; in __fma()
90 if (hx >= 0x7ff00000 || hy >= 0x7ff00000 || (hx | xx.i[1]) == 0 || in __fma()
91 (hy | yy.i[1]) == 0) /* x or y is inf, nan, or zero */ in __fma()
120 ey = hy >> 20; in __fma()
/illumos-gate/usr/src/lib/libm/common/complex/
H A Dk_atan2l.c725 int ix, iy, hx, hy; in __k_atan2l() local
727 hy = HI_XWORD(y); in __k_atan2l()
729 iy = hy & ~0x80000000; in __k_atan2l()
747 return ((hy >= 0)? pio2 : -pio2); in __k_atan2l()
760 *w = (hy >= 0)? pi_lo : -pi_lo; in __k_atan2l()
761 return ((hy >= 0)? pi : -pi); in __k_atan2l()
769 return ((hy >= 0)? pio2 : -pio2); in __k_atan2l()
772 *w = (hy >= 0)? pi_lo : -pi_lo; in __k_atan2l()
773 return ((hy >= 0)? pi : -pi); in __k_atan2l()
806 *w = (hy >= 0)? w2 : -w2; in __k_atan2l()
[all …]
H A Dk_atan2.c459 int ix, iy, hx, hy, lx, ly; in __k_atan2() local
461 hy = ((int *) &y)[HIWORD]; in __k_atan2()
463 iy = hy & ~0x80000000; in __k_atan2()
484 return ((hy >= 0)? pio2 : -pio2); in __k_atan2()
497 *w = (hy >= 0)? pi_lo : -pi_lo; in __k_atan2()
498 return ((hy >= 0)? pi : -pi); in __k_atan2()
506 return ((hy >= 0)? pio2 : -pio2); in __k_atan2()
509 *w = (hy >= 0)? pi_lo : -pi_lo; in __k_atan2()
510 return ((hy >= 0)? pi : -pi); in __k_atan2()
547 *w = (hy >= 0)? w2 : -w2; in __k_atan2()
[all …]
H A Dcsqrtf.c44 int ix, iy, hx, hy; in csqrtf() local
49 hy = THE_WORD(y); in csqrtf()
51 iy = hy & 0x7fffffff; in csqrtf()
90 if (hy < 0) in csqrtf()
H A Dcsqrtl.c51 int n, ix, iy, hx, hy; local
56 hy = HI_XWORD(y);
58 iy = hy & 0x7fffffff;
143 if (hy < 0)
H A Dctanh.c100 int hx, ix, lx, hy, iy, ly; in ctanh() local
108 hy = HI_WORD(y); in ctanh()
110 iy = hy & 0x7fffffff; in ctanh()
173 if (hy < 0) in ctanh()
H A Dctanhf.c42 int hx, ix, hy, iy; in ctanhf() local
49 hy = THE_WORD(y); in ctanhf()
50 iy = hy & 0x7fffffff; in ctanhf()
112 if (hy < 0) in ctanhf()
H A Dctanhl.c43 int hx, ix, hy, iy; in ctanhl() local
50 hy = HI_XWORD(y); in ctanhl()
51 iy = hy & 0x7fffffff; in ctanhl()
115 if (hy < 0) in ctanhl()
H A Dcsinh.c84 int hx, ix, lx, hy, iy, ly, n; in csinh() local
92 hy = HI_WORD(y); in csinh()
94 iy = hy & 0x7fffffff; in csinh()
134 if (hy < 0) in csinh()
H A Dcsinhf.c44 int hx, ix, hy, iy, n; in csinhf() local
51 hy = THE_WORD(y); in csinhf()
52 iy = hy & 0x7fffffff; in csinhf()
99 if (hy < 0) in csinhf()
H A Dcsinhl.c42 int hx, ix, hy, iy, n; in csinhl() local
49 hy = HI_XWORD(y); in csinhl()
50 iy = hy & 0x7fffffff; in csinhl()
90 if (hy < 0) in csinhl()
H A Dcsqrt.c123 int n, ix, iy, hx, hy, lx, ly; in csqrt() local
129 hy = HI_WORD(y); in csqrt()
132 iy = hy & 0x7fffffff; in csqrt()
207 if (hy < 0) in csqrt()
H A Dcpow.c156 int ix, iy, hx, lx, hy, ly, hv, hu, iu, iv, lu, lv; in cpow() local
165 hy = ((int *) &y)[HIWORD]; in cpow()
172 iy = hy & 0x7fffffff; in cpow()
209 t = (hy >= 0)? 0.25 : -0.25; in cpow()
212 t = (hy >= 0)? 0.75 : -0.75; in cpow()
215 r = (hy >= 0)? u : -u; in cpow()

12345